Phone calls and music limitation is for the TomTom Rider 500/550. It allows you to make calls from it by triggering the Google digital assistant on an Android phone or Siri on an iPhone but then you are not able to talk to someone using the microphone a paired headset, you have to talk directly into the microphone on the phone.
If someone calls you then you can answer the call on the TomTom's screen, see who it is using Caller ID and talk into the microphone on a paired headset but you are not able to hang up the call in any way. The other person has to end the call.
It also doesn't have a music player so you can't listen to music using that GPS.
A GPS device like the Garmin 590LM or the 660 / 665 does not have these kinds of limitations.
If you have a GPS like the TomTom Rider or a Garmin paired to your Sena headset then you can still pair one more device like the SR10.
